  3. PROTAC VHL-type degrader-1

PROTAC VHL-type degrader-1 (compound 9b) is a VHL-type PROTAC degrader. PROTAC VHL-type degrader-1 induces ATM degradation synergistically enhancing the efficacy of ATR inhibitor AZD6738.

  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
